    It was more of a comment on the changes to (pretty much all) international tournaments recently which seem more designed to kick the arse out of the TV contract with interminable rounds and even different competitions (see Nations League) to qualify.

    Conf League - After the first 6 rounds of games have been played, 24 out of the initial 36 in the Conference League have at least one round guaranteed after christmas.

    Thats not a coincidence, its been designed this way.

    There is a glut of football on the TV at the moment, and while people will go "aye, its champions league tonight, I will watch X v Y" I imagine that the viewing figures for the conference league are as low as it gets.


    Thats not to say that I wouldnt love Hibs to gain the £5m Hearts have got, by the way.
